**Ticket: Blue-green cutover stalls billing worker**

During last night's blue-green deploy of the Ledgerly billing worker, green instances accepted traffic before warm-up finished, causing retried invoices. Support: affected invoices auto-reconcile within an hour; no customer action needed. Fix adds a readiness gate. Patched build token is below.

pipeline stamp: htk4_ae36

Ticket: Slimmed base image for Farrowbox agent breaks curl-based health checks.

Severity: P2. After switching to the distroless variant in the Lintpress pipeline, support reports probes failing on customer installs. Root cause: slimming stripped ca-certificates and the shell used by legacy check scripts. Fix in progress: re-add certs, migrate probes to the built-in status binary. Affected versions: 4.2.0–4.2.3. Tell customers to pin 4.1.9 until patched. Reference the bad build using the token below.

session token of tajef-bageg = htk21_5d90d574934f3ccae6437

Effective next fiscal year, all Casperline platform contracts will move from monthly to annual invoicing. Please note the implications carefully: deferred revenue recognition schedules must be rebuilt, proration rules apply to mid-cycle conversions, and existing monthly customers retain grandfathered terms until renewal. Reconciliation of accounts receivable should be completed before cutover, and any discrepancies escalated promptly. The commercial rationale for this change is set out in the confidential note below.

board note of fahif-yahog: Gross margin on Wenath came in at 10 percent against a plan of 5 percent. Only 3 of the 100 pilot accounts renewed Wenath, so a churn review is set for July 15.